What Does an Ivistry Commercial Trainee Do?

Before we jump into the Ivistry Commercial Trainee salary, it's important to understand what the role actually entails. As a commercial trainee at Ivistry, you'll be immersed in the world of business, gaining hands-on experience in various departments. This could include sales, marketing, customer service, and even operations. The specific responsibilities will vary depending on the department you're assigned to, but the overall goal is to learn the ropes of the business and develop the skills needed to become a successful commercial professional. You can expect to be involved in a variety of tasks, from assisting with sales presentations and analyzing market trends to managing customer accounts and developing marketing campaigns. Basically, you are the jack-of-all-trades, learning every aspect of the company and how it all works together.

Core Responsibilities and Daily Tasks

Commercial trainees typically work under the guidance of experienced professionals, learning by doing and receiving feedback along the way. Your daily tasks might involve:

  • Market Research: Analyzing market trends, identifying potential customers, and staying up-to-date on industry developments.
  • Sales Support: Assisting with sales presentations, preparing sales reports, and following up with potential clients.
  • Customer Relationship Management: Handling customer inquiries, resolving issues, and building strong relationships with clients.
  • Marketing Activities: Contributing to the development and execution of marketing campaigns, analyzing campaign performance, and identifying areas for improvement.
  • Data Analysis: Collecting and analyzing data to identify business opportunities, track sales performance, and make data-driven decisions.
  • Administrative Tasks: Handling administrative tasks such as preparing meeting minutes, scheduling appointments, and managing documents.

Factors Influencing Salary

Several factors can influence the Ivistry Commercial Trainee salary. These include:

  • Location: Salaries can vary significantly depending on your location. For example, trainees in major metropolitan areas might earn more due to the higher cost of living.
  • Experience: Prior experience, even if it's not directly related to the role, can influence your salary. Relevant experience, such as internships or part-time work, can demonstrate your skills and knowledge.
  • Education: Having a relevant degree, such as a Bachelor's degree in business, marketing, or a related field, can also impact your salary.
  • Performance: Your performance during the training program can lead to salary increases and bonuses. Consistently exceeding expectations can result in higher compensation.
  • Negotiation Skills: Your ability to negotiate your salary during the hiring process can also influence your starting salary.

Salary Ranges Based on Location

As we mentioned, location matters. Here's a sample of salary ranges for commercial trainees in different locations (these are estimates and can vary):

  • Major Metropolitan Area: Starting salary: $50,000 - $65,000 + benefits
  • Mid-Size City: Starting salary: $45,000 - $55,000 + benefits
  • Smaller Town: Starting salary: $40,000 - $50,000 + benefits

Career Progression within Ivistry

Here's a simplified example of how a commercial trainee might progress within Ivistry:

  1. Commercial Trainee (1-2 years): Focus on learning, developing skills, and gaining experience.
  2. Junior Commercial Professional (2-3 years): Take on more responsibilities, contribute to projects, and demonstrate a solid understanding of the business.
  3. Commercial Professional (3-5 years): Manage projects, lead teams, and take on increased responsibilities.
  4. Senior Commercial Professional (5+ years): Lead departments, develop strategies, and play a key role in the company's success.
